Limits of manifolds with boundary II

Abstract

In this paper, as a continuation of [34], we consider the Gromov-Hausdorff convergence and collapsing in the family of compact Riemannian manifolds with boundary satisfying lower bounds on the sectional curvatures of manifolds, boundaries and the second fundamental forms of boundaries, and an upper diameter bound. We describe the local geometric structure of the limit spaces, and establish some stability results including Lipschitz homotopy stability.
